Backflow Prevention 101


Before going to the benefits of backflow testing, it’s important to understand how backflow prevention works.



Water distribution systems are designed to maintain a significant pressure to allow water to flow from the faucet, shower, and other water fixtures. A good functioning backflow preventer protects clean water supplies from polluted or contaminated water due to backflow.



However, when water pressure occurs due to burst or frozen pipes, polluted water from other sources travels backward – soon entering the potable water distribution system. That’s when air gap and backflow prevention devices come into play.


Atmospheric Vacuum Breaker


n AVB prevents the backflow of contaminated liquids into the main potable water system. It’s usually installed at least six inches above the peak usage point, such as sprinklers.


Prevents Structural Damage


As water travels backward, it hits the surrounding structures which put them at risk of sustaining added pressure that can cause corrosion and other forms of damage. Therefore, backflow testing is vital to keep the walls intact and moisture-free.


Backflow testing is also a great way to keep your plumbing system intact and in good working order. Backflows could damage your plumbing system, which can worsen if you troubleshot a backflow yourself.


Protects Community Health


When all backflow prevention devices in the community undergo annual inspection and testing, then there’s a lower chance of having contaminated water.



Without regular backflow testing, the members from the surrounding area may suffer from water-borne diseases. Examples include amoebiasis and bacterial gastroenteritis due to drinking polluted water.



For this reason, the government enforces strict backflow testing compliance to cities and municipalities with corresponding imposed penalties for violators. The authorities require districts to install backflow preventers and have a backflow prevention plan.


For One’s Peace Of mind


Regular backflow testing can provide you peace of mind that your drinking water is clean or free from unwanted substances, such as bacteria, viruses, parasites, and heavy metals.
